Ravens take on team from division above

FC Isle of Man will be hoping today marks the start of a memorable cup competition journey.

The Ravens are taking on Avro FC in the second qualifying round of the FA Vase this afternoon (25 September).

Heading into this, the Manx side have secured back-to-back wins in their last two league games.

After thrashing Cammel Laird 6-1 on the Wirral on 4 September, they overcame Stockport Town with a 3-2 victory last week (18 September).

However, the Island team will face a side this weekend currently playing in the division above them.

Avro FC, based in the Limeside area of Oldham, Greater Manchester, play in North West Counties Football League Premier Division.

In the league, they have five wins, one draw, and three defeats from their opening nine games.

This includes two wins in their last two against Congleton Town and Squires Gate.

FC Isle of Man will take on Avro FC at the Vestacare Stadium from 2pm this afternoon.
